Translingual
Han character
涐 (Kangxi radical 85, 水+7, 10 strokes, cangjie input 水竹手戈 (EHQI), four-corner 33150, composition ⿰氵我)

Chinese
Glyph origin
Phono-semantic compound (形聲 / 形声, OC *ŋaːl): semantic 氵 (“river”) + phonetic 我 (OC *ŋaːlʔ).
